144. Deputy Pearse Doherty asked the Tánaiste and Minister for Justice and Equality if she has requested a new report from An Garda Síochána into undercover policing by the British Metropolitan Police; if the scope of this new report will include any matters relating to Northern Ireland; if this report will seek to determine if the Garda requested the assistance of the British Metropolitan Police; if this report will investigate if any Irish protest groups were the target of the surveillance; and if she will make a statement on the matter. [31903/16]
